Output c69c38df715da94ab1858801163463721d669011cfb37877f6a1ceee5e15ae31:38

value
129109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 423e5c01650a04efd828b9cc6047cb3cc318ee2b OP_EQUAL
address
37jHE1cWvdpkVRH2kNfjeMZMYcLVxnsT4c
transaction
c69c38df715da94ab1858801163463721d669011cfb37877f6a1ceee5e15ae31
spent
true